Do you have a 4 year old through 2nd grader? This learning opportunity is for you! Our Partners at PRI and Waterford are offering this program to families in the Owsley County School District at no cost. Families commit to 15 minutes a day 5 days a week to use a computerized learning platform that will adapt to student needs. Computers and internet access are avalaible for those who qualify. Register through the link below or QR code on the flyer. Sign Ups end 10/31

Rory Mason and Erica Mason teamed up and had their design chosen for KYTC District 10 "Paint the Plow” project! Students from JAG, art, and agriculture classes will work together to bring the idea to life. Watch for their finished design on a snowplow rolling through this winter!
